Samyang announce XEEN 14mm T3.1 and 35mm T1.5 Cine lenses

Korean lens maker Samyang have just added two new cine lenses to their XEEN lineup. The XEEN 14mm T3.1 and 35mm T1.5 complement the existing 24mm T1.5, 50mm T1.5 and 85mm T1.5 lenses and create a versatile five lens kit.

All five lenses cover full-frame sensors and come in PL, EF, F, E, and MFT mounts. You can also choose between metric and imperial focus scales.

Like other entry level cinema lenses these designs are improved versions of their stills counterparts. It comes as little surprise that the XEENs follow the maximum apertures of the sister Samyang VDSLR range of less expensive plastic-bodied lenses. This limits the 14mm to a slower maximum aperture than the other lenses in the lineup – something that may disappoint users who had been hoping for a new optical design so that the XEENs would be a constant T1.5 set.

In our previous tests of the other XEEN lenses we found that they resolve very well and should be well suited to higher resolution cameras like the RED Weapon and Scarlet-W. How the new lenses compare will be interesting given their lineage.

Samyang have also stated that there will be two more XEEN lenses announced in the second half of 2016.

The 14mm and 35mm lenses will be available in March. The UK price is set at £1599 including VAT each.
